The intra-articular anatomy of 103 equine tarsi was studied by contrast radiography with image intensification and computerized tomography. There was communication between the tarsometatarsal and distal intertarsal joints in 21 of 55 (38%) interpretable tarsometatarsal arthrograms, and in 11 of 48 (23%) interpretable distal intertarsal arthrograms. The difference was not significant. The volume of contrast agent and the pressure of injection did not correlate with communication. Forced injection caused subcutaneous leakage of contrast medium but not communication. Communication occurred via the tarsal canal and the space between the third and the combined first and second tarsal bones. Injection of the distal intertarsal joint from the dorsomedial aspect of the limb, distal to the palpable distal border of the medial branch of the tendon of the tibialis cranialis muscle and between the central, third, and combined first and second tarsal bones, provided reliable access except in the presence of severe periosteal proliferations.  相似文献

Polyclonal antibodies were produced against sonicated and heat-killed cells of Pseudomonas syringae pv. pisi strain UQM551 and Pseudomonas syringae pv. syringae strain L, and their specificities were compared. Evidence is presented that the serological specificity between these two pathovars lies in surface antigens. Of the surface antigens purified and tested, only flagella and lipopolysaccharide from the cell wall showed no cross-reactivity with heterologous antisera. Antisera to glutaraldehyde-fixed flagella of the two strains showed a high level of specificity. At a species or genus level, antisera prepared from heat-killed cells of P. syringae distinguished this species from all other bacterial species and genera tested, including strains of Pseudomonas fluorescens, Escherichia coli, Agrobacterium and Rhizobium.  相似文献

Silviculture of ash in southern England   总被引:1,自引:0,他引:1  
KERR  G. 《Forestry》1995,68(1):63-70
In 1992 the Wessex Silvicultural Group held a number of meetingsto study the silviculture of ash, during which 16 sites throughoutcentral southern England were visited. Ash can produce valuabletimber on relatively short rotations, and to take full advantageof this potential stands must be carefully managed. The mainpoints to consider are: (1) site selection: ash is site demandingand grows best on moist calcareous barns of pH 6 to 7. Sitesprone to frost should be avoided. (2) Spacing: if timber productionis an important objective, ash should be established with atleast 2500 stems ha-1 on bare land and 2000 stems ha-1 on restockingsites. It is sensitive to exposure when young and requires sideshelter making it unsuitable for pure planting on exposed ground.(3) Weed control: this is essential for successful establishment.It is recommended that an area of at least 1 m2 around eachtree should be kept weed free for at least 3 years. (4) Protection:the species is relatively free from squirrel damage but is palatableto voles, rabbits, hares and deer. Protection using appropriateindividual tree protection or fencing is essential. (5) Thinning:once a height of 6–7 m has been reached ash should havefrequent crown thinnings to maintain a live crown over at leastone-third the height of the tree. Under-thinning was by farthe most common fault in the stands visited.  相似文献

A technique for temporary hepatic vascular occlusion during partial hepatectomy for hepatic arteriovenous (AV) fistulas in the dog is presented in seven dogs, and three additional cases of hepatic AV fistulas are reviewed. Hematologic, serum biochemical, radiologic, and nuclear scintigraphic parameters before and after surgery are discussed; abnormalities included anemia, hypoproteinemia, leukocytosis, increased liver function tests, retrograde filling of the portal vein during celiac angiography, and increased arteriovenous ratios during nuclear scintigraphy. Hemodynamic and pathologic findings are presented, and portal hypertension and secondary multiple portosystemic shunts are described. Clinical improvement was observed in four dogs with follow-up periods ranging from 5 months to 3 years.  相似文献

KERR  G. 《Forestry》1998,71(1):49-56
Black heart is a non-fungal stain of ash (Fraxinus excelsiorL.) which results in a price penalty compared with white wood.The formation of black heart varies within individual trees,between trees and on different sites; the evidence availablesuggests that it can be present in up to 45 per cent of treesat age 60. Once formed the proportion of cross-sectional areaaffected increases with age. Previous work has suggested thatblack heart has no effect on timber properties or strength butits occurrence has been linked with high soil moisture. Howeverthese studies were conducted in the 1950s and need to be confirmedusing more rigorous research methods. Scope exists for innovativemarketing of black heartwood to emphasize that it is a naturalfeature and can be visually pleasing; this may lead to betterreturns for the grower.  相似文献

In China, some areas with intensive agricultural use are facing serious environmental problems caused by non-point source pollution(NPSP) as a consequence of soil erosion(SE). Until now, simultaneous monitoring of NPSP and SE is difficult due to the intertwined effects of crop type, topography and management in these areas. In this study, we developed a new integrated method to simultaneously monitor SE and NPSP in an intensive agricultural area(about 6 000 km2) of Nanjing in eastern China, based on meteorological data,a geographic information system database and soil and water samples, and identified the main factors contributing to NPSP and SE by calculating the NPSP and SE loads in different sub-areas. The levels of soil total nitrogen(TN), total phosphorus(TP), available nitrogen(AN) and available phosphorus(AP) could be used to assess and predict the extent of NPSP and SE status in the study area.The most SE and NPSP loads occurred between April to August. The most seriously affected area in terms of SE and NPSP was the Jiangning District, implying that the effective management of SE and NPSP in this area should be considered as a priority. The sub-regions with higher vegetation coverage contributed to less SE and NPSP, confirming the conclusions of previous studies, namely that vegetation is an effective factor controlling SE and NPSP. Our quantitative method has both high precision and reliability for the simultaneous monitoring of SE and NPSP occurring in intensive agricultural areas.  相似文献
